InterContinental Adds Five Holiday Inn Hotels In UK
InterContinental
Hotels Group PLC announced the signing of a franchise agreement for five Holiday
Inn hotels in the UK owned by Stardon, a joint venture company formed between
Starwood Capital Europe and Chardon Hotels.
The hotels, managed by Chardon Management, will undergo significant
refurbishment to meet Holiday Inn brand standards, and will be operated under
a twenty year franchise agreement.
Andrew Cosslett, chief executive officer, InterContinental
Hotels Group, commented, 'The Holiday Inn UK portfolio now stands at 100 hotels
and continues to out perform the market. We are delighted to be working with
Starwood Capital Europe and Chardon who are both well respected in the hospitality
industry."
Maurice Taylor, director, Stardon and chief executive, Chardon
Management, said, We are delighted to be growing the number of properties
we operate with IHG. Our commitment to Holiday Inn extends back over 12 years
and during this time we have been successfully involved in all areas of the
brand as an experienced hotel operator and franchisee. Having considered all
options currently available, with a global brand and highly developed support
system, IHG offer the best franchise option for these hotels.
